众多解决方案和资料
尽在本公司 基于AI大模型的All In One知识库平台!
支持AI搜索问答、文档笔记、 思维导图、演示Slide PPT等功能,
并且还提供任务管理和项目管理功能。
立即注册,智能获取更多解决方案资料,并可一键生成演示Slide PPT!
Excel作为微软Office套件中的核心组件,凭借其强大的数据处理能力和灵活的表格操作,成为了企业、学术及个人用户进行数据整理、分析和报告的首选工具。无论是简单的数据记录,还是复杂的财务分析、市场调研,Excel都能提供高效的支持。
随着数据量的不断增加,Excel的数据处理能力也在不断进化,通过函数、公式、图表以及宏编程等功能,用户可以轻松实现数据的筛选、排序、汇总、计算及可视化展示,极大地提升了工作效率。
然而,在数据处理过程中,尤其是在数据的导入导出环节,用户常常会遇到一些挑战,其中之一便是如何正确处理字符串中的单引号。单引号在数据格式中扮演着重要角色,尤其是在处理文本数据时,其正确与否直接影响到数据的准确性和后续处理的顺利进行。
在将数据从Excel导出到其他格式(如CSV、TXT等)或从外部数据源导入到Excel时,字符串中的单引号问题尤为突出。由于不同系统或软件对单引号的处理方式存在差异,可能导致数据在导入导出过程中出现格式错乱、数据丢失或解析错误等问题。
例如,在CSV文件中,单引号常被用作文本定界符,如果数据本身包含单引号,而未经适当处理直接导出,则可能导致接收方软件无法正确解析数据。
此外,从外部数据源导入数据时,如果数据源中的文本字段未用单引号标记,Excel可能会将其误认为是公式或函数的一部分,从而导致数据解析错误。
单引号在数据格式中的重要性不言而喻。它不仅是文本字段的标识符,还是确保数据在导入导出过程中保持原样、不被误解析的关键。在Excel中,通过在文本字符串前添加单引号,可以强制Excel将其视为文本而非数值或公式。
因此,在处理包含文本数据的Excel文件时,掌握如何正确拼接单引号显得尤为重要。这不仅能够确保数据的准确性和完整性,还能提高数据处理的效率和可靠性。
Excel提供了多种公式和函数来帮助用户实现字符串的拼接和格式化。其中,利用公式拼接单引号是一种简单有效的方法。用户可以通过将单引号作为字符串的一部分,与需要拼接的文本数据组合在一起,形成完整的文本字符串。
CONCATENATE函数是Excel中用于连接两个或多个文本字符串的函数。用户可以将单引号作为其中一个参数传递给CONCATENATE函数,以实现字符串与单引号的拼接。例如,`=CONCATENATE("'", A1)`可以将A1单元格中的文本数据前加上单引号。
虽然TEXT函数主要用于将数值转换为文本并应用指定的数字格式,但通过与字符串拼接技巧结合使用,也可以实现类似的效果。例如,`=TEXT(A1, "'@")`可以将A1单元格中的数值转换为文本格式,并在其前添加单引号(注意:这里的单引号作为格式代码的一部分,实际上并不直接显示在结果字符串中,但可以达到类似的效果)。然而,对于纯文本数据而言,更推荐使用CONCATENATE函数或`&`运算符。
Excel中的“&”运算符是另一种实现字符串拼接的强大工具。与CONCATENATE函数相比,“&”运算符更加灵活易用,且支持多个字符串的连续拼接。用户只需将需要拼接的字符串和单引号用“&”连接起来即可。
“&”运算符的基本语法非常简单,即将需要拼接的字符串用“&”连接起来即可。例如,`="'" & A1`可以将A1单元格中的文本数据前加上单引号。这种方法不仅适用于单个字符串的拼接,还支持多个字符串的连续拼接。
在复杂场景下,用户可能需要将多个字符串和单引号以特定的顺序拼接在一起。此时
1、在Excel中,如何快速给字符串添加单引号进行拼接?
在Excel中,给字符串添加单引号进行拼接通常是为了在导入或导出数据时保持文本格式不变,特别是当数据中包含数字或特殊字符时。一种快速的方法是利用Excel的文本函数`&`来拼接单引号和字符串。例如,如果你想给单元格A1中的字符串添加单引号,可以在另一个单元格中输入公式`="'"&A1`,然后按Enter键。这样,如果A1的内容是`example`,则结果将是`'example'`。此外,还可以使用`TEXT`函数结合`&`来实现更复杂的格式设置。
2、为什么需要在Excel中拼接字符串时添加单引号?
在Excel中拼接字符串时添加单引号主要是为了保持数据的文本格式。当Excel处理数据时,它会自动识别并尝试将内容转换为最合适的格式,比如将看起来像数字或日期的字符串转换为数字或日期格式。这可能导致数据在导入或导出到其他系统时出现问题,因为格式可能不符合预期。通过添加单引号,可以明确指示Excel将该内容视为文本,从而避免自动格式转换的问题。
3、有没有批量给Excel中的字符串添加单引号的方法?
是的,Excel提供了多种批量给字符串添加单引号的方法。一种常见的方法是使用Excel的`TEXT`函数结合`&`操作符,通过公式实现。例如,假设你想给A列中的所有字符串添加单引号,可以在B列的第一个单元格中输入公式`="'"&A1`,然后拖动填充柄(位于单元格右下角的小方块)以将该公式应用到B列的其他单元格中。另一种方法是使用Excel的“查找和替换”功能,但这通常适用于在字符串的特定位置添加单引号,而不是在每个字符串的开头添加。
4、在Excel中拼接字符串时,如何避免单引号被当作文本的一部分?
在Excel中拼接字符串时,如果你不希望单引号被当作文本的一部分,而是仅仅作为保持文本格式的手段,那么实际上你不需要担心这个问题,因为单引号在Excel中仅用于指示随后的字符应被视为文本。然而,如果你是在处理导出到CSV或其他文本格式的情况,并且希望单引号不被包含在内,那么你可能需要在导出之前对数据进行清理,或者使用VBA宏等高级功能来编写自定义的导出逻辑,以排除不必要的单引号。
理解Python程序启动执行的方式 启动Python程序的基本概念 什么是Python环境 Python环境指的是安装了Python解释器及相关库文件的计算机系统,它为运行Python代码提供了必要
...一、入门Python爱心代码的基础 1. Python基础简介 1.1 了解Python语言的特点与优势 Python是一种高级编程语言,以其简洁清晰的语法而闻名。它的设计理念强调代码的可读性和
...理解高效学习编程的基础 明确学习目标与方向 确定你的兴趣领域 在开始编程之旅之前,首先要对自己感兴趣的领域有所了解。这可能涉及到前端开发、后端服务、移动应用或是游
...
发表评论
评论列表
暂时没有评论,有什么想聊的?